Output ca66407b8694e99701172cde0c0119740f41241f156c30b4a714402f70675d83:0

value
2328250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d0b598bf3ce0666758e98238d62e3c8dbbcbe2a OP_EQUAL
address
34Lb7ho9yhSyPT9QTKpVjsRfQkwM4ktGF4
transaction
ca66407b8694e99701172cde0c0119740f41241f156c30b4a714402f70675d83